Cruise Control

On models equipped with cruise control, the system is operated by the PCM/VCM. PCM/VCM receives inputs from VSS, servo diaphragm position sensor, cruise control switch and brake release switch. Based on these inputs, PCM/VCM controls position of cruise control stepper motor. PCM/VCM prevents system engagement at speeds of less than 25 MPH. PCM/VCM is not serviceable; if defective, it must be replaced. A system fault is stored as a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) in PCM/VCM memory.
